Business Licensing in Santee

Anyone who conducts business within the City of Santee is required to obtain a city business license. This includes businesses headquartered outside the city that enter Santee to conduct commerce, home-based operations, and residential rental properties with four or more units. Licenses are non-transferable; ownership changes require a new application. Issuance of a business license does not supersede applicable zoning or building regulations.

Important Dates & Deadlines

Renewal Due Date

On or before the expiration date printed on the license (anniversary of issuance date — no single city-wide calendar deadline); 30-day grace period before late penalties begin

Renews annually

Late Payment Penalties

$17.50 per month for each month the license remains unrenewed after the grace period; out-of-city businesses are exempt from late fees

What You Need to Apply in Santee

Completed application and payment; Home Occupation businesses must also submit a signed Home Occupation Rules Sheet; non-owner applicants must include a Property Owner Authorization form

Business licenses in Santee are non-transferable — a new application is required whenever ownership changes. Residential rental properties with four or more units must also be licensed. Fees are nonrefundable even if the license is later revoked for zoning non-compliance.

Who Is Exempt from Santee Business Licensing?

Out-of-city businesses are exempt from late fees. No full exemptions from the licensure requirement are stated in official sources; residential rentals with 4 or more units are explicitly required to obtain a license.

Fee Schedule

FeeAmountPeriod

New business license

New business license — (includes mandatory AB-1379 state disability access fee)

$108one-time

Annual renewal — (includes AB-1379 fee)

$42annual

Home Occupation initial — (includes AB-1379 fee)

$58one-time

Home Occupation renewal

$42annual

Cottage Food Operation initial — (includes AB-1379 fee)

$62one-time

Cottage Food Operation renewal

$42annual

Change of address or name (in-city only)

$48annual

How to Get a Business License in Santee, CA

Follow these steps to obtain your Santee business license. Requirements vary by business type, but this is the general process for most businesses in Santee, CA.

1

Choose Your Business Structure

Before applying for a Santee business license, determine your entity type (sole proprietorship, LLC, corporation, partnership). Your structure affects which licenses you need and how you register with California and the IRS.

2

Check Zoning Requirements

Verify that your business location in Santee is zoned for your intended use. Contact the Santee Planning Department for zoning verification. Home-based businesses typically need a home occupation permit.

3

Register with the State of California

Register your business entity with the California Secretary of State (if applicable), obtain an EIN from the IRS, and register for state tax obligations including sales tax and employer withholding.

4

Apply for Your Santee Business License

Submit your business license application to the Finance Department. Applications can typically be submitted online, in person, or by mail. Include all required documentation and fees.

5

Obtain Additional Permits

Depending on your industry in Santee, you may need additional permits — health department permits for food service, fire department approval, alcohol licenses, professional licenses, or industry-specific certifications.

6

Display Your License and Stay Compliant

Once issued, display your Santee business license prominently at your place of business. Licenses renew annually. Track renewal deadlines to avoid penalties and late fees.
